About the position

As a Health Informatics Analyst at Stryker Sage, you will play a crucial role in enhancing data analytics and reporting capabilities focused on value-based care and patient safety. This position involves analyzing clinical quality data, building reporting solutions, and providing insights that improve patient care and operational efficiency. You will work with various healthcare data sources to identify trends and support decision-making processes that lead to better patient outcomes and financial health for healthcare partners.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ze clinical quality data and build reporting solutions to enhance outcomes and health economic value.
  • Capture, structure, and analyze publicly-reported healthcare data from various databases to identify trends and insights.
  • Analyze data on hospital performance metrics, such as readmission rates and patient satisfaction scores.
  • Conduct analyses using CMS Pay for Performance data to optimize resource allocation and reduce costs.
  • Support decision-making by providing evidence to healthcare providers on the impact of interventions on CMS performance targets.
  • Develop and maintain automated reporting solutions for health economic and value-based care competencies.
  • Generate and distribute regular reports on key performance indicators (KPIs) and present findings to stakeholders.
  • Participate in the implementation and evaluation of health informatics and health economic projects.
  • Follow data handling and reporting regulations and standards, such as HIPAA.
